Petit-Rocher (2011 population: 1,908) is a Canadian village in Gloucester County, New Brunswick.Located on Chaleur Bay 20 km northwest of Bathurst, Petit-Rocher's residents are 92% Francophone.Its current population meets the requirements for "town" status under the Municipalities Act of the Province of New Brunswick, however the community has not requested a change in municipal …
